【问题标题】:rsync error: error in rsync protocol data stream (code 12)rsync 错误:rsync 协议数据流中的错误(代码 12)
【发布时间】:2023-04-09 14:52:01
【问题描述】:

我正在尝试执行 rsync 以将 500GB 的文件从一台服务器传输到另一台服务器。我用这个命令;

rsync -vrPt -e 'ssh -p 2222' uname@server.com:/folder /newfolder

它可以正常工作并同步大约 10/15 分钟,然后每次都会抛出此错误;

rsync:连接意外关闭(收到 5321016884 字节,所以 far) [receiver] rsync: writefd_unbuffered 未能将 4 个字节写入 socket [generator]: Broken pipe (32) rsync 错误: rsync 中的错误 io.c(1525) [generator=3.0.6] rsync 处的协议数据流(代码 12) 错误:在 io.c(600) [receiver=3.0.6] 的 rsync 协议数据流(代码 12)中出错

可能是什么问题?

【问题讨论】:

    标签: shell unix ssh rsync scp


    【解决方案1】:

    看起来是路由器超时了 NAT 表条目。 (我假设其中一台服务器在 DSL 链接上。)

    或者它可能是这样的:“空闲连接导致路由器或远程外壳服务器关闭连接。”来自http://rsync.samba.org/issues.html

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 1970-01-01
      • 2014-04-09
      • 2014-01-11
      • 2011-09-10
      • 1970-01-01
      • 2019-05-08
      • 1970-01-01
      • 1970-01-01
      相关资源
      最近更新 更多